Daniel D Overland Park , KS November 14, 2014 Not spin drying no agitation lots of noise Called repair man, told him it was making noise and not spinning. he told me that it was a GE and that i should put in on the curb. Opened the washer up myself and found a broken clip. Ordered the clip and it was there almost 24 hours later with standard shipping and the washer is back to normal. Kerrilyn C Avondale , AZ May 23, 2015 Would not spirit We took apart the washer and noticed the clip to hold the transmission had snapped. Ordered clip and replaced it. Cleaned the tub and agitator before fixing clip. Runs like a champ! Read More... 6 People found this story helpful Do-It-Yourself Rating: Repair Time Estimate: 15-30 minutes Tools: Screwdrivers
